    Here's my 1981 Bass Tracker III, It's not fast and it's not purdey, But She get's me on the lake where the crappie are!!!!

    Attachment 75976Attachment 75974Attachment 75979Attachment 75985Attachment 75986Attachment 75987Attachment 75980Attachment 75981Attachment 75982Attachment 75975Attachment 75977Attachment 75978Attachment 75983Attachment 75984

    I removed all the 1/2" plywood and Styrofoam and replaced it with 3/4" plywood and high density Styrofoam. I re-wired the whole boat, replaced the fuse block, replaced the bilge pump, re-did the live well, installed new freshwater pump, recirculation pump, and 12v aerator, installed a separator in live well for minners, painted the console and replaced all the switches and installed a carbon fiber switch plate, installed two new batteries and a Minn Kota on board charger, made the front upper deck bigger, new carpet throughout, side by side seats on front deck, install a net holder, and Driftmaster rod holders and tip savers.

    Quote Originally Posted by waxnslabs View Post
    Where did you get the rod holders that are on the side of your boat? (ones not for fishing but just to hold your pole while moving.)
    WS you can get them from Grizzly Jig.2 models one is centered and one is offset. Then if you want them higher you can use a piece of all thread to screw into the mount that comes with them then engineer a mont to install the holder to. Think they are about 35.00 a set.
